We have observed highly virtual (Q(2) > 1.05 GeV2) photon-photon colli
sions to hadronic final states at root s(e+e-) = 58 GeV. The integrate
d luminosity of the data sample was 241 pb(-1). Both scattered beam-el
ectrons and scattered beam-positrons were detected using low-angle cal
orimeters (i.e., both photons were highly virtual, ''double-tag'');we
obtained 115 hadronic events with an estimated background of 10.2 +/-
1.1. The cross section obtained was 4.11 +/- 0.66 pb in the 2 < W-gamm
a gamma < 25 GeV and Q(gamma,min)(2) > 2 GeV region, while the lowest
order quark-parton model predicted 3.00 pb.
